Technical Specifications of Siemens 1FK7063-2AF71-1RG0
Specification
Details
Brand
Siemens
Model
1FK7063-2AF71-1RG0
Product Type
Servo Motor
Series
SIMOTICS S Servo Motor
Application
Precision Motion Control, Industrial Automation
Shaft Height
63 mm
Motor Technology
Permanent Magnet Servo Motor
Feedback System
Integrated Servo Feedback
Installation Type
Industrial Machine Integration
Weight
11.10 kg (24.47 lb)

4. What causes servo motor feedback alarms?
Possible causes include encoder connection problems, incorrect configuration, signal interference, or damaged feedback components.
5. How can users troubleshoot servo motor performance reduction?
They should inspect load conditions, drive parameters, wiring connections, mechanical alignment, and operating environment.
6. Why is servo motor tuning necessary after installation?
Proper tuning improves response speed, reduces vibration, and ensures accurate positioning performance.
7. What causes servo motor torque instability?
Possible causes include overload conditions, incorrect drive settings, mechanical resistance, or unstable control signals.
